Back in 1967, Ron Peskin was working at his uncle’s deli when he was offered the opportunity to purchase a struggling Los Angeles Jewish deli called Brent’s. By sheer coincidence, his young son’s name also happened to be Brent, so he took it as a sign and bought the deli. More than 50 years later, Ron continues to run the now-iconic Brent’s Deli along with his family. A commitment to high standards, top-quality ingredients, and family values has cemented Brent’s Deli’s reputation as one of the very best Jewish delis in America.

Reuben Sandwiches
- Remove desired amount of pastrami and place on microwave-safe dish.
- Cover with plastic wrap and microwave in 10 to 15 second increments until the meat is evenly heated
- Put slices of rye in a pan with oil to grill them. Once one side has been lightly toasted, remove from pan and place to the side.
- Put sauerkraut on the pan to heat it up. While sauerkraut is heating, spread russian dressing on the two sides of bread that have already been grilled.
- Take the swiss cheese and place it on one side of the bread, adding the sauerkraut on top.
- Add your pastrami and the second slice of bread to assemble the sandwich.
- Place the sandwich back on the pan to grill the bread and melt the cheese.
- Enjoy!
